Biosketch

Kimberly Avery, DO, is an emergency physician. She received a Bachelor of Science degree in Health Science from Corban University in Salem, Oregon. She is a graduate of Western University of Health Sciences COMP-NW in Lebanon, Oregon. She completed her residency in Emergency Medicine at Cape Fear Valley in Fayetteville, North Carolina. In July of 2024 she will begin her fellowship in Emergency Medical Services at Western Michigan University Homer Stryker 六合彩开奖直播 School of Medicine. Her clinical, teaching, and research interests include first responder wellness, and women's health. Her goal is to develop obstetric protocols that allow women to remain in their careers while having healthy pregnancies. She also enjoys being a member of fire teams, and search and rescue teams.
